Fredrik Adelöw 32f0dfe7f8 incremental-ingestion: use ANY(array) instead of IN(...) on Postgres
The whereIn('ref', refs) calls on ingestion_mark_entities generated
a unique prepared statement for every distinct array length, bloating
the Postgres query plan cache. On Postgres, use = ANY($1) with a
single array parameter instead. Falls back to regular whereIn on
SQLite/MySQL.

Fredrik Adelöw bc32c13de6 catalog-backend: add missing index on relations.target_entity_ref
The relations table had indexes on originating_entity_id and
source_entity_ref but none on target_entity_ref. Several query paths
join or filter on this column:

- Orphan deletion (LEFT JOIN relations ON target_entity_ref)
- Entity ancestry (INNER JOIN relations ON target_entity_ref)
- Eager pruning (JOIN relations ON target_entity_ref)

Without an index these queries seq-scan the full table (~3.5M rows,
714 MB heap). On a production replica, a single point lookup takes
~122ms via seq scan. With the index it drops to <1ms.

The index is ~141 MB based on column width (~35 bytes avg) across
~3.5M rows. On PostgreSQL it's created with CONCURRENTLY to avoid
blocking reads/writes.

MT Lewis 2bd0450cb4 feat(catalog-backend-module-msgraph): filter out disabled users by default (#34165)
* feat(catalog-backend-module-msgraph): filter out disabled users by default

The Microsoft Graph provider now always applies an `accountEnabled eq true`
base filter when fetching users. Any custom `user.filter` is combined with
the base filter using `and`, so adopters no longer need to manually add
`accountEnabled eq true` to their configuration.

Also removes the legacy mutual exclusivity check between `userFilter` and
`userGroupMemberFilter` — these serve orthogonal purposes (user-level
filtering vs group selection) and the downstream code already handles
both being set.

benjdlambert 219cc05885 fix(create-app): remove disabled nav-item config that breaks custom sidebar
The nav-item extensions were disabled in the template config to prevent
duplicate rendering, but the custom sidebar already handles this via
nav.take(). After #33788 added filtering of disabled nav items from page
discovery, disabling them causes nav.take('page:catalog') to return
nothing, breaking the sidebar navigation.

Ben Lambert 07ec25de2c fix(catalog-backend): move generateStableHash out of shared util to fix Storybook build (#34284)
* fix(catalog-backend): move generateStableHash out of shared util to fix Storybook build

The util.ts file mixed Node.js-only code (createHash from node:crypto)
with pure constants. Since InMemoryCatalogClient reaches into
buildEntitySearch via a relative import, and buildEntitySearch imports
from util.ts, the node:crypto dependency leaked into Vite's browser
bundle causing the Storybook build to fail.

Fredrik Adelöw aa313f099c github: stabilize entity order in multi-org provider
When using GithubMultiOrgEntityProvider with alwaysUseDefaultNamespace
and teams with identical slugs across orgs, the emitted entity order
was non-deterministic. Since the catalog's upsert path uses last-write-
wins for duplicate entity refs, this caused the winning org to flip
randomly on every refresh cycle, producing constant unnecessary
stitching and flickering entity data.

Sort the emitted entities by entity ref (primary) and location
annotation (tiebreaker) so that the same org consistently wins when
duplicate refs exist.

Fredrik Adelöw ada7df7929 backend-test-utils: add version field to mock credentials
The mock credentials created by mockCredentials.none(), .user(), and
.service() were missing the internal version: 'v1' field. This caused
toInternalBackstageCredentials() to throw when used with mock
credentials in tests.

Fredrik Adelöw 8165184fba tests: use describe.each for database test iteration
Refactors all test files that use TestDatabases/TestCaches with
it.each(databases.eachSupportedId()) to instead use describe.each at
the outer level. This ensures that all tests for one database engine
complete before moving to the next, rather than interleaving engines
across individual tests. This reduces the number of concurrent database
connections and should help with test timeout issues in CI.

The TestDatabases.create() call is hoisted to module scope so the
describe.each can iterate over supported IDs at the top level.

40 files changed across packages/backend-defaults,
packages/backend-test-utils, and multiple plugins.
